Transaction 07e0576a9cd8c24a0921bd913d3e3c99a8496f90d2df9bfac24f59539e8abccb
1 Input
2 Outputs
- 07e0576a9cd8c24a0921bd913d3e3c99a8496f90d2df9bfac24f59539e8abccb:0
- 07e0576a9cd8c24a0921bd913d3e3c99a8496f90d2df9bfac24f59539e8abccb:1
value 2949328
address 16LModMWs6aPE7KGKpTYppLsVrohBcuYa8
value 3564404
address 12efgjm7iCZozA4T8GiNZF9ZBPNf9kEq4F